Based on Production Method
Based on production method, wet process with advanced purification accounts for a growing share as thermal-process capacity declined following elemental phosphorus facility closures. Modern solvent extraction and crystallization achieve food and pharmaceutical grades from phosphate rock, with cost advantages over thermal processing. Thermal process maintains a significant share for specialized applications requiring ultra-high purity.
